WebMerit Bonus Pay is designed to recognize outstanding performance without employee expectation of continual receipt of an award. The amount of the Merit Bonus Pay awarded to an employee shall be in the range of 1-5% of their base annual salary. WebA merit increase is a performance-based pay increase that adds to an employee’s overall salary. Organizations use them to reward high performance and exemplary work. Merit increases take many forms — including bonuses, pay raises, and temporary salary increases. They may be part of a promotion, but not necessarily. ‍. Web16 feb. 2024 · What is a Merit Increase vs. a Pay Raise? Merit increases focus on your staff's performance towards a goal, whereas simple pay raises are just arbitrary increases based on their duration of time at the company or cost of living adjustments.
